Career GuideKey Responsibilities
- Meet with clients to confirm training goals and learner needs
- Create course plans and lesson materials
- Deliver live training in person or online
- Build self paced learning content
- Create hands on exercises and practice scenarios
- Assess learner progress with quizzes and practical checks
- Collect feedback and improve materials
- Maintain a consistent training experience across sessions
- Coordinate scheduling, logistics, and learner communications
- Track results and report outcomes to clients
- Stay current on product updates and industry changes
- Manage contracts, pricing, invoicing, and client relationships

Common Skill Gaps
Often Missing Skills
Pricing StrategyContract NegotiationPipeline BuildingTraining MetricsLearning Platform AdministrationVideo ProductionContent Accessibility
Development SuggestionsBuild a repeatable process for client discovery, proposal writing, and follow up. Add a small set of measurable outcomes to every engagement, such as proficiency checks and post training adoption metrics. Create a lightweight content production workflow so you can reuse and update materials quickly.
Salary & Demand
Median Salary Range
Entry LevelUSD 60,000 to 85,000 per year
Mid LevelUSD 85,000 to 120,000 per year
Senior LevelUSD 120,000 to 170,000 per year
Growth Trend
Stable to growing demand, supported by ongoing software adoption, security training needs, and remote learning. Independent work is common, with income variability based on client pipeline and specialization.Companies Hiring
